Pueyo Vineyards
Winemaker Christophe Pueyo cultivates approximately 8.5 hectares of vineyards around Libourne in the Bordeaux region, on gravelly, low-fertility soils that are ideal for the ripening of Merlot, Cabernet Franc, and Cabernet Sauvignon. He follows a natural approach, having begun the transition to organic farming in 2010, with a strong focus on soil health, biodiversity, and viticulture that respects living organisms.
In the winery, Pueyo favors fermentation with native yeasts, without chemical additives, and aging in tanks, large oak casks, or sometimes amphorae, depending on the vintage. This approach aims to allow the purity of the fruit, the identity of the Saint-Émilion terroir, and the aromatic freshness of the wines to shine through.
